Rome police evacuate Colosseum after suspect can found

Other News Materials 7 August 2011 23:24 (UTC +04:00)

A suspect tin can that prompted officials to evacuate the Colosseum on Sunday was found not to contain explosives, Italian media reports said.

Experts destroyed the can as a precaution after visitors were made to exit the Ancient Roman amphitheatre, the ANSA newsagency reported.

A piece of string that emerged from the can had raised fears that it could contain a detonating device, DPA reported.

The bomb scare happened at around 5:30 pm.

On Sunday the Colosseum closes to visitors at 6:00 pm.
